Jerry Palmer is currently serving as Director of Missions for the Heartland Baptist Association located in Lawson Missouri, a postition he has held for 13 years. While he has been at Heartland, Jerry is serving as Chairman of Trustees, Executive Board Member at Grand Oaks Baptist Assembly; Advisory Board, Missouri DOM Fellowship; Webmaster for Grand Oaks Camp & Missouri DOM Fellowship and Certified State Stewardship Specialist.
Jerry previously served as pastor of the First Baptist Church of Lockwood Missouri; pastor of the First Baptist Church of Gainesville, Missouri; pastor of the Second Baptist Church of Ash Grove, Missouri and pastor of the Pilot Grove Baptist Church near California, Missouri. Also, he has previously served on the Missouri Baptist Convention Executive Board, Continuing Review Committee and the Tellers Committee.
Jerry Palmer graduated from Midwestern Baptist Theological Seminary - Kansas City, Missouri with a Doctor of Ministry on December 14, 2007. Jerry did about half of his Master of Divinity (47 Hours) at the Southern Baptist Theological Seminary and received a Masters of Divinity from Midwestern Seminary - Kansas City, Missouri. Jerry's undergraduate work was at Southwest Baptist University, Bolivar, Missouri.
Jerry, his wonderful wife Linda and their son, David are actively involved in the Institute for Historic & Educational Arts. The Palmers demonstrate at the Jefferson City, Missouri Renaissance Festival and the Kansas City Renaissance Festival. Jerry works in the Woodwright Shop, Linda works in the Fiber Arts Area and David builds custom armor.
Jerry is certified in Show-Me Faithful Stewardship Process, conflict mediation/resolution, various Strategy Planning Processes, Thy Kingdom Come Consultant; Next Level Leadership: Building Powerful Ministry Teams, Supervision Training Level 1 & 2, Basic Disaster Relief Training, Situational Leadership Training and the Building For Tomorrow Capital Fund-raising.
